Maine is about 72 times bigger than Hong Kong.

Hong Kong is approximately 1,108 sq km, while Maine is approximately 79,931 sq km, making Maine 7,114% larger than Hong Kong. Meanwhile, the population of Hong Kong is ~7.3 million people (5.9 million fewer people live in Maine).
